The 5 most common mistakes in carpet cleaning

Many people think that carpet cleaning is a very simple thing that anyone can do. Well that’s not really true. Before starting the whole process, you should know the most suitable methods to remove dirt or stains and extend the life of your carpet. Here are some common mistakes people make:

Do not clean up spills immediately. Letting a spill dry on the carpet will make it much more difficult to clean. You should know that liquids seep deeper into the carpet padding, leading to unpleasant odors and mold growth. Eventually, the stain will also erode the fibers of the carpet. So when a spill does happen, clean it up right away to avoid more serious problems with your carpet.

Using too much water or cleaning products. Large amounts of water and cleaning solutions are often difficult to absorb. In that case, you’d better dry the rug with a steam cleaner, otherwise it may re-grow mold. Another common mistake is using strong cleaning products. They can damage the fibers or dissolve the colors in your carpet. That’s why you should carefully read cleaning solution labels to see if they contain unwanted formulas or chemicals.

Spot cleaning is definitely not the best idea for your carpet. Sure, after scrubbing hard you can remove the stain, but at the same time it will seriously damage the carpet fibers. It will be much more effective to blot the stain with a towel. Then wait some time for it to absorb and then use a stain remover to clean it.

Cleaning too often: You should clean your carpet only when it is really necessary. Excessive scrubbing and excessive use of cleaning chemicals can have a very negative effect. They could cause color fading or even more serious damage to the carpet. Remember, more is not always better.

Neglect hiring a professional carpet cleaning company. Many people do not want to call a professional service for help because of the extra costs they have to incur. But that is not always the right decision. Yes, most of the time you can clean your carpet properly without help. However, in cases of badly damaged carpets or frequent stains from children and pets, it is better to call the specialists. Otherwise, the damage can become permanent, leaving you with no choice but to buy a new carpet.
